Student-athletes make splash, perform swimmingly at states

Feb. 19, 2020

Contributed by Kyle Galdeira

A pair of student-athletes from KS Kapālama collected individual gold medals at the HHSAA/K. Mark Takai Swimming and Diving State Championships on Saturday at Kihei Aquatic Complex.

Junior Shaye Story won the girls 200-yard freestyle (1 minute, 53.54 seconds) and the 500-yard freestyle (5:01.87).

Senior Noa Copp claimed the 50-yard freestyle in a personal-best mark of 21 seconds, and also won the 100-yard freestyle in 45.98 seconds.

Copp also notched a 20.91-second pace in the third leg of the 200-yard freestyle relay, which the KS boys team won in 1:29.58. The winning relay squad also included seniors Devin Alejado and Dane-Kaulukou-Chang as well as sophomore Nash Brandon.

The KSK boys squad finished second overall behind Punahou, while the girls team secured third place after all 26 individual events were completed.
